  3. I'm not sure what is going on here... I migrated to a new server and everything came up with no problem. I did put new data cables on the drives. It was working and then all of a sudden the disk went into an error state. I rebuilt the disk (it took 24 hours) and everything looked good. No problems. About an hour after the rebuild, after trying to write some data to the server, the disk went into error state again! This time I saved the logs (attached). The main problem seems to be this: May 22 19:01:06 Tower kernel: ata2: SATA link down (SStatus 0 SControl 300) ### [PREVIOUS LINE REPEATED 2 TIMES] ### May 22 19:01:17 Tower kernel: ata2.00: disable device May 22 19:01:17 Tower kernel: ata2.00: detaching (SCSI 2:0:0:0) May 22 19:01:17 Tower kernel: sd 2:0:0:0: [sdc] Synchronizing SCSI cache May 22 19:01:17 Tower kernel: sd 2:0:0:0: [sdc] Synchronize Cache(10) failed: Result: hostbyte=0x04 driverbyte=DRIVER_OK May 22 19:01:17 Tower kernel: sd 2:0:0:0: [sdc] Stopping disk May 22 19:01:17 Tower kernel: sd 2:0:0:0: [sdc] Start/Stop Unit failed: Result: hostbyte=0x04 driverbyte=DRIVER_OK May 22 19:01:23 Tower kernel: md: disk1 read error, sector=8590496000 May 22 19:01:23 Tower kernel: md: disk1 write error, sector=8590496000 Does this sound like a data cable? I find it was weird that the entire rebuild worked no problem, but then it fails as soon as data was being written to it. I'm clueless. Any help? tower-diagnostics-20230522-1908.zip
